![]() JHENIDAH, Oct 26:–An underground Janajudda cadre was shot dead allegedly by his rivals at Gopalpur in Kotchandpur upazila late Tuesday night, reports UNB. Witnesses said Shahin, the victim, was sitting in a tea stall at Gopalpur bazaar when 5 or 7 unidentified men dragged him out at gunpoint at about 11pm. The brutes shot him in his mouth.

2 JP activists bombed to death in Narail Oct 26: At least two activists of the Jatiya Party (JP-Ershad) were killed in a bomb attack at remote Akdiarchar village in southwestern Narail district Wednesday evening. After the double murder, a tense situation was prevailing in the area, sources said. The deceased were identified as Nazrul Islam (50) and Swapan Boiragi, both residents of Kolora union under Narail Sadar upazila. Witnesses said a gang of miscreants hurled two bombs at them in front of Akdiarchar Club when they were on way home from the local bazaar soon after the Iftar.
Sources said soon after the killing, the locals became agitated and tried to demonstrate along with the bodies.
Dread Terror Subrata Bain in city ? Fugitive underworld don Trimoti Subrata Bain Suvra, is believed to be in the city now to celebrate the Eid-ul-Fitr with his family and friends. Subrata Bain, who has converted to Islam from Christianity, is now named Fateh Ali Khan. Subrata Bain has been implicated in the case relating to the August 21 grenade attacks on an Awami League rally at Bangabandhu Avenue last year. A source close to Subrata, preferring anonymity, told BDNEWS that he has been staying in the capital for a week now. But the source did not say where the dreaded terror is staying. According to the source, Subrata Bain crossed into Bangladesh through a land port some 15 days ago. "Some influential people provided shelters to Subrata in Bogra, Pabna and Dinajpur on his way to Dhaka. Bain was also provided security and shelter when he entered Dhaka where his wife and children are residing," the source added. The source said that after coming to the capital, Subrata has been keeping in touch with his underworld aides over telephone. According to the confessional statement of Arman, another top terror, Subrata Bain and Khandakar Nazrul Islam Joy masterminded the grenade attacks on the Awami League rally. The attack left 23 people, including central AL leader Ivy Rahman, killed. The opposition leader Sheikh Hasina escaped death by seconds in the attack. But she suffered serious injuries in her ear. Another source added notorious terrors Zishan alias Monti and Rony of Maghbazar also returned to the country from India recently, to celebrate Eid with their relatives. Zishan, implicated in killing two members of DB police, is also a most wanted criminal declared by the Interpol. Zishan and Rony lived at Laketown in Kolkata. An intelligence official, on condition of anonymity, however, told BDNEWS that they did not have such information. The government declared a bounty of Tk 15 lakh each for the 23 notorious criminals of the capital on December 27, 2001. | ||||||||||
